Man pleads guilty in killing of goose

A man accused of killing a pet Canada goose named Wee Wee has pleaded guilty to shooting wildlife out of season.

David Gregory Davis, 48, of Marysville was fined $1,229 after entering the plea this week in Yuba County Superior Court.

Wee Wee was considered part of the family after Todd Hulsey and Sherri Neel rescued him as a gosling from the Sacramento River more than a year ago. He waited for them at the gate to their property, rode in their boat when they went fishing and flew behind a motorcycle driven by Hulsey. Neel posted a sign along a private road that said, “Please Don’t Shoot The Pet Goose.”
